Sobers hits six sixes in Swansea
The great Garry Sobers completed the feat of hitting six sixes in one over at St Helen’s, Swansea, on 31 August, 1968. The West Indian batsman was playing for Nottinghamshire against Glamorgan and hammered Malcolm Nash for a maximum 36 runs off one over. He was caught on the boundary off the fifth ball by Roger Davis, but the fielder fell back over the rope and conceded six runs.
